Synaptic Gap
The tiny space between neurons, across which neurotransmitters travel to transmit signals from one neuron to another.
Sending Neuron
The neuron that transmits a signal to another neuron across a synapse, sending information through the nervous system.
Receiving Neuron
A neuron that receives signals from other neurons through its dendrites in a process crucial for neural communication.
Reuptake
The process by which neurotransmitters are taken back into the synaptic vesicles of a neuron after being released, thereby terminating the signal between neurons.
